Since writing my previous blog post, "Placing Video & Photos into Your Blog", I have received several inquiries asking how I got these screen shots (with comments) into the blog. Below is the answer.
PRINT SCREEN BUTTON:
The secret to printing, manipulating and posting screen shots from your computer is simple.
#1. Push the "Prnt Scrn" (Print Screen) button on your keyboard. Pushing the Prnt Scrn button will copy whatever is showing on your computer screen.
NOTE: Some keyboards require that you push the "Prnt Scrn" button in combination with the Alt or Shift button to capture a screen shot.
#2. Next step is to paste the copied screen shot into your favorite graphics program (e.g., publisher, photoshop, illustrator or paint).
#3. Manipulate the image of your copied screen as you see fit.
#4. Save image as a JPEG or GIF.
#5. Upload your new image to your Google/Picassa account; see my previous blog "Placing Video & Photos into Your Blog" for details.
#6. Use the appropriate HTML code to reference this new image in your blog post; see my previous blog "Placing Video & Photos into Your Blog" for details.
